Triton Minerals [ASX:TON] - Multiple High-Grade Graphite Zones Confirmed at Nicanda Hill

Triton Minerals Limited (ASX: TON) is extremely pleased to confirm additional assay results from the RC drilling program, has now verified newly identified high grade zones of the graphite mineralisation at Nicanda Hill.

Highlights:

* Additional drilling results have delineated newly identified hanging wall higher grade zones

* Selected significant interesections of weighted average graphite carbon (GrC), include:
* 34m at 9.5 per cent GrC in GBNC0005
* 80m at 10.3 per cent GrC in GBNC0006
* 24m at 12.2 per cent GrC in GBNC0006
* 30m at 11.6 per cent GrC in GBNC0006
* 24m at 9.1 per cent GrC in GBNC0007
* 16m at 10.3 per cent GrC in GBNC0009

� Drilling is now focused on testing the continuity of the multitude of interpreted high grade zones

� Drilling to date has demonstrated the continutity and consistency of graphite mineralisation over a strike length of 2.5km between drilled holes and trenches

� The horizontal width of the graphite mineralization at surface is expanded to 1,000m and still remains open to the northwest

� The drilling results continue to correlate strongly with the VTEM survey data

� Second diamond drill rig mobilized to support and accelerate operations at Nicanda Hill

� Refined scoping study now extended to include Nicanda Hill

The identification of even more high grade zones to the west of the orginal HG1 zone, whilst maintaining an overall average of 11 per cent graphite carbon, is a very encouraging result for the Company. Further, the drilling has also expanded the horizontal width of the graphite mineralization zone to an exceptional 1,000m. These are very exciting results for Triton and they continue to show the world class potential of the Balama North project, Triton Minerals Managing Director Brad Boyle said.
